BUFFALO, New York, June 19 -- The U.S. Attorney for the Western District of New York, James P. Kennedy Jr., issued the following news release:
U.S. Attorney James P. Kennedy, Jr. announced today that Presiliano Garcia, 33, who was convicted of misprision of a felony, was sentenced to three years probation by U.S. District Judge Elizabeth A. Wolford.
